iOS系统的应用签名是苹果公司用于安全验证App应用的一种方式,其目的是确保用户的设备上的App均为合法、可信的。在iOS系统中,每个App都需要一个签名来验证其来源和完整性企业微信有多可怕。
苹果签名的流程包括以下几步:
在进行iOS签名之前,开发人员需要先申请成为苹果开发者账号的一员,成为开发者账号可获得签名权限并发布应用, Apple Developer Program 提供了三种类型的帐户:
个人账户:允许个人开发者上传和发布应用;ios企业证书申请
公司账户:允许公司开发者上传和发布应用;
企业账户:允许企业开发者上传和发布应用,也可用于内部分发。
注册完开发者账号后,苹果会为开发人员颁发开发者证书,用于验证开发者身份。开发者需要在Xcode中设置“团队”选项来使用该证书。
在对应开发者账号中,创建一个唯一的 App ID 来标识应用。为了验证App的真实性,在创建App ID时,开发者需要指定一个特定的 bundle ID,该ID必须与开发者证书以及App应用中所使用的bundle ID相匹配。
在创建App ID后,开发人员需要根据应用类型选择相应的描述文件,描述文件将应用ID、开发者证书、应用权限等信息打包,可用于安装设备和应用审核。
开发者需要将目标设备加入开发者账号,以便测试时安装应用。在Xcode中,添加设备的方法为,打开 “Preferences” --> “Accounts” --> “View Details” --> “Devices” --> “+” --> 输入设备UDID。
在以上步骤完成后,开发者可以对应用进行配置、编译、打包、上传的操作。其中,打包操作会将应用签名和描述文件打包到.ipa文件中,开发者可以将该文件上传到苹果服务器上进行审核和发布。
以上是iOS系统进行应用签名的几个主要步骤,通过这些步骤,开发者可以确保所上架的应用是合法、可信的。不过,需要注意的是,苹果公司时刻更新其签名政策,开发人员需要及时了解最新签名政策,并进行相应的调整。
iOS签名:苹果设备越狱必备技能 随着iOS系统的升级和苹果设备的普及,苹果设备的安全性越来越高,越狱也变得越来越困难苹果企业签名工具怎么用。然而,在某些情况下,越狱是许多用户必须进行的操作,为此,...
iOS设备使用方法:安装苹果企业签名教程ios企业级签名 在开始安装苹果企业签名之前,我们需要了解苹果签名,iOS签名以及企业签名的基本知识。苹果签名指的是在iOS设备上运行的应用程序被苹果安全认证...
iOS App重签名方法及注意事项 iOS签名是指只有得到苹果官方签名的应用才可以在iOS设备上运行的机制,这个机制保证了iOS设备的应用安全。但是,有时候我们可能需要对App进行重签名,例如需要发...
iOS设备必须了解的苹果签名知识ios企业证书限制人数 什么是苹果签名? 苹果签名指的是苹果公司对于iOS应用的数字签名认证,只有经过苹果签名的应用才能够在iOS设备上进行安装与使用苹果证书信任设...
找回或重新生成iOS证书是关键 对于iOS开发者来说,iOS证书是开发和发布iOS应用的关键组成部分。然而,有时可能会遇到iOS证书丢失的情况。本文将介绍如何解决这个问题,并提供详细的步骤。...
什么是iOS签名? iOS签名是指向苹果官方服务器注册并获取相应证书,从而使非官方应用程序可以在iOS系统上运行。一般情况下,iOS设备只能安装经过苹果官方认证的应用程序,这就意味着,如果开发者想要...